Contents:
1. An Overview of International Arbitration ; 2. The Agreement to Arbitrate ; 3. Applicable Laws ; 4. The Establishment and Organisation of an Arbitral Tribunal ; 5. Powers, Duties, and Jurisdiction of an Arbitral Tribunal ; 6. Conduct of the Proceedings ; 7. The Role of National Courts during the Proceedings ; 8. Arbitration under Investment Treaties ; 9. The Award ; 10. Challenge of Arbitral Awards ; 11. Recognition and Enforcement of Arbitral Awards
Summary: In the fifth edition, this classic text is updated to incorporate reference to all of the latest significant developments in the field. Provides a fuller treatment of investment treaty arbitration, and international arbitration beyond the UK and Europe.
